Best Sports Bra Brands For Running



4 week health and fitness programme



This is the place to go if you're searching for the best sports bras for running. There are many styles and sizes to choose from. Finding the right one can be easy. Below are some of our top picks. They'll help you maintain your fitness while you run, exercise, or just plain do the job. You can consult a store to learn more or check out reviews on the internet.

It is important to consider your cup size and fit when purchasing a bra for sports. A sports bra should fit snugly and offer plenty of support. Fortunately, there is a bra out there for every size and budget. Brooks, Champion and Sweaty Betty make great sports bras to fit A and/or B-cups. For D-cup women, Syrah is a good choice. Although the best sports bra for large busts might not be available in your normal cup size, it is still possible to order it in a small-to-large size.

Brooks Running Bras have been designed for women who train in the gym or run. They are supportive and comfortable. The adjustable straps allow for a racerback look. It includes an underwire for extra support and separate cup support to support your breasts. Although the back closure is convenient and machine washable, it may not be ideal for those who sweat often or wish to show off their midriff in public.

Sweaty Betty sportsbras have mesh inserts for support and padded bra straps for your breasts. Elizabeth Corkum, the owner of Y7 hot yoga studio, highly recommends this bra. The Sweaty Betty comes in a range of cup sizes, including A-G, and even F. You can wear it alone or layer it under a strappy shirt.

Are There Any Benefits to Yoga?

Yoga has existed since ancient times. It has only recently been more popular. Yoga is now very fashionable among celebrities and everyday people who want to look and feel good.

Yoga is great for strengthening and stretching your muscles. It also relaxes your mind and makes you calmer.

Yoga and other forms exercise differ in that yoga is focused on breathing techniques.

To improve your balance and flexibility, you can try different poses.


Cardio Exercise: Good or Bad for Your Health?

Cardiovascular exercise is a great way to improve your cardiovascular health. It improves blood circulation, strengthens your heart muscle, increases stamina, helps you lose weight, and gives you energy.

Cardiovascular exercise includes running, biking, hiking, swimming, tennis, basketball, soccer, volleyball, football, etc.

It is important to keep in mind that cardio exercises should not only be performed at a high level of intensity, but also at low levels. This could cause injury.

Only do the cardio exercise when you are feeling good.

Never push yourself past your limits. You could injure yourself if you do.

When you engage in cardiovascular exercise, it is best to warm up first. Gradually increase the intensity.

Remember, you should always listen to your body. If you feel pain, stop doing cardio exercise immediately.

It is also recommended to take some time off after a cardiovascular exercise. This gives your muscles the chance to heal.

Calcium is required to support strong bones. Calcium can be found in dairy products such as yogurt, fortified soybean beverages, orange juice, cereals, bread, and cereals.

Calcium is found in leafy green vegetables and beans, tofu as well as nuts, seeds, cheese, and seeds.

Vitamin D is essential for calcium absorption. Vitamin D is found in certain fortified foods, such as egg yolk and fatty fish.

Vitamin E is essential for skin health. It's found in vegetable oils, wheat germ oil, peanuts, almonds, sunflower seeds, and corn.

Your body requires zinc to function normally and for wound healing. Zinc is found in seafood, oysters legumes meats, whole grains, whole grains and meats.

Zinc deficiency could cause fatigue, nausea, vomiting, and depression.
